Job Summary

The PACE Driver operates under the direction of the Supervisor, PACE Transportation and is responsible for the direct transportation of physically limited passengers to and from various destinations. Position requires constant interaction with caregivers and community agencies.

Accountabilities

  • Responsible for driving a specially equipped van to deliver physically limited persons to varied destinations. Assures that wheelchair lifts and tie down equipment are properly operated and that participants are delivered to appointments in a timely manner. - 35%

  • Ensures that passengers get on and off the van safely.\u00A0 Interacts with participants in a courteous manner. Operates medical equipment as needed. Responds to emergencies that may arise in accordance with established protocols. - 25%

  • Responsible for maintaining established schedules, adjusts schedules to meet unanticipated changes, determines the safest and most efficient pick-up and delivery routes. - 20%

  • Ensures vans maintain a clean, orderly and safe condition. Reports maintenance issues as needed. - 10%

  • Responsible for completing documentation as required. - 5%

  • Participates as a member of the Interdisciplinary Team.\u00A0 Attends staff meetings and takes part in participant care planning.\u00A0 Communicates any changes in participant condition to team members. - 5%

Supervisory/Management Responsibilities

This is a non-management job that will report to a supervisor, manager, director or executive.

Minimum Requirements

  • High School Diploma or Equivalent

  • 1 year - experience with a frail or elderly population

Required Certifications/Registrations/Licenses

SCDL - SC DRIVERS LICENSE

Other Required Sills and Experience

Acceptable five year motor vehicle record and valid certificate of auto insurance.
